Culp, Inc. Announces Retirement of Howard L. Dunn

    HIGH POINT, N.C.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Dec. 20, 2004--Culp, Inc.
(NYSE: CFI) today announced that Howard L. Dunn, Jr., vice chairman of
Culp, will retire from his management position effective December 31,
2004. Dunn (67) will continue to serve on the company's Board of
Directors.
    Dunn, one of the founders of Culp, has served in various senior
management positions with responsibilities for the areas of sales,
design and product development, and manufacturing. He served as
president and chief operating officer of Culp from June 1993 until May
2004 when he assumed the role of vice chairman. In this capacity, Dunn
held executive responsibility for Culp's China operations and has also
stayed involved in the company's design and product development
activities.

    Culp, Inc. is one of the world's largest marketers of mattress
fabrics for bedding and upholstery fabrics for furniture. The
company's fabrics are used principally in the production of bedding
products and residential and commercial upholstered furniture.
